Ver Mensaje Individual
  #17 (permalink)  
Antiguo 26/06/2013, 15:31
Avatar de miguec04
miguec04
 
Fecha de Ingreso: agosto-2008
Ubicación: Cimitarra, Santander
Mensajes: 378
Antigüedad: 15 años, 8 meses
Puntos: 15
Respuesta: Como hacer un case en php y organizar consulta para mostar

Código PHP:
Ver original
  1. if ($_POST['buscador']) {
  2.     // Tomamos el valor ingresado
  3.     $buscar         = $_POST['palabra'];
  4.     // Si está vacío, lo informamos, sino realizamos la búsqueda
  5.     if(empty($buscar)) {
  6.         echo "No se ha ingresado una cadena a buscar";
  7.     } else {
  8.         // Conexión a la base de datos y seleccion de registros
  9.         $con            = mysql_connect($bdServerName, $bdServerUser, $bdServerPassword);
  10.         $numcolumna     = 2;
  11.         $sql            = "// aqui realizo la consulta con UNION a las 5 tablas";
  12.  
  13.         mysql_select_db("$bdName", $con);
  14.         $result     = mysql_query($sql, $con);
  15.         // Tomamos el total de los resultados
  16.         $total      = mysql_num_rows($result);
  17.         $array      = array();
  18.         // Imprimimos los resultados
  19.         if ($total>0) {
  20.             echo "<tr><td><b>Resultados Consulta General Transitos</b></td></tr> ";
  21.             echo "<tr><td colspan=\"$numcolumna\">Hay $total elementos</td></tr>";
  22.             $i          = 1;
  23.             $actual     = NULL;
  24.             while($fila = mysql_fetch_array($result)){
  25.                 $array['N'.$fila['NUMERO_TABLA']][]     = $fila;
  26.             }
  27.             $datosTabla1            = $array['N1'];
  28.             foreach($datosTabla1 as $dt) {
  29.                 echo '<tr><td>Cache: '.$dt['cache'].'</td></tr>';
  30.             }
  31.            
  32.             $datosTabla2            = $array['N2'];
  33.             foreach($datosTabla2 as $dt) {
  34.                 echo '<tr><td>Cache: '.$dt['cache'].'</td></tr>';
  35.             }
  36.         } else {
  37.             echo "<tr><td>0 elementos encontrados</td></tr>";
  38.         }
  39.     }
  40. }

Espero esta si sea la solución.
__________________
Desoftc Technology - Miguel Carmona
Creaciones Inteligentes - Cimitarra Colombia
[email protected]
http://www.desoftc.com.co